Create Time Offs
Security: Set Up: Time Off (Calculations - Absence Specific) domain in the Time Off and Leave functional area.
You can create definitions for time offs, enabling workers to record time away from work. When workers request time off, they can select from the time off definitions for which they're eligible.

Option Description PriorityAssign a priority for processing the time off when multiple time offs subtract from the same time off plan. Workday processes time offs in the order from highest priority to lowest when a worker takes more than 1 time off during the same processing period. Enter a unique value as the priority for each time off. Example: Multiple time offs subtract from the same time off plan balance, and a worker requests absence against each time off object during the same processing period.The priority, combined with a lower time off limit on the time off plan and limit override value on the time off, or both, can affect paid and unpaid time off.Adjustments AllowedSelect to allow adjustments to be made on this time off.Hide from Worker Self ServiceSelect to prevent workers from requesting time off through self-service pages.Alternatively, you can set up segmented security for time off to control access to specific time offs using time off security segments and segment-based security groups. Display Start and End TimeDisplays when you select anEntry Optionvalue ofEnter through Time Off Only.Select for workers to enter values for start and end times when entering time off.Start and End Time RequiredDisplays when you select anEntry Optionvalue ofEnter through Time Off Onlyand theDisplay Start and End Timecheck box.Select to require workers to enter values for start and end times when entering time off.Calculate Quantity Based on Start and End TimeDisplays when you select 1 of theseEntry Optionvalues:- Enter through Time Off Onlyand theStart and End Time Requiredcheck box.
- Enter through Time Tracking and Time Off.
Select to prevent workers from overriding the number of hours for the daily quantity. When you select the check box:- The quantity of time that workers request per day equals the duration of time between the start time and end time.
- Workday ignores the daily quantity default.
- Workday automatically selects theDisplay Start and End TimeandStart and End Time Requiredcheck boxes.
- Workday populates theDaily Quantityvalue on the time off request, so workers can't override the value.
Available on theEdit Time Offtask when the time off is linked to an hour-based plan only.When you don't select the check box, workers can override the number of hours for the daily quantity when entering time off. Example: You select theDisplay Start Time and End Timecheck box on the time off. A worker later requests time off and enters a start time of 8:00 AM and an end time of 5:00 PM. Workday autopopulates theDaily Quantityfield with 9 hours, but the worker can override this value by entering 8 hours.Enable Crossing MidnightAvailable only when you select 1 of theseEntry Optionvalues:- Enter through Time Off Only, and you also select theDisplay Start and End Timecheck box.
